Julia Domna. Augusta, AD 193-217. Æ Sestertius (32.5mm, 28.79 g, 6h). Rome mint. Struck under Caracalla, AD 211-215. IVLIA PIA FELIX AVG, draped bust right / IVNONEM, S C across field, Juno standing facing, head left, holding patera in outstretched right hand and vertical scepter in left; at feet to left, peacock standing left, head right. RIC IV 585b; Banti 21. Green patina, smoothed, numerous scratches, flan crack. VF.

From the Jack A. Frazer Collection. Ex Stack's (7 December 1994), lot 2257.

From an issue unusual in its rendering of Juno's name in the Latin accusative case.
